Leadership Theory

The Leader-Member Exchange (LMX) Theory of leadership is different from the other theories and approaches you have studied so far. You have studied approaches and theories that focus on the leader. You have also studied approaches and theories that focus on the context or situation between the leader and the subordinate. LMX Theory sees leadership as a process that focuses on the interactions between leaders and subordinates.

Transformational Leadership is different again, in that it studies leaders who are able to inspire subordinates to accomplish great things. Transformational leaders are seen as leaders who create a clear and shared vision, who empower subordinates to meet high standards, develop trust, and are change agents.

In reference to the dyadic relationship that exists in LMX theory, it is placated upon the theory that leaders' and the relationships they develop with their subordinates and team members can be a contributor to success if these relationships are positive and healthy or could result in dysfunction and limit employee growth if these relationships are not positive and unhealthy. There exists a vertical dyadic linkage between leaders and team members wherein the leader is either a facilitator of positive relationships that allow employees to grow or facilitates an environment that withholds employee growth. This theory focuses on four set principles that include role-taking, which is the first stage wherein the manager under the LMX theory assesses any new member to ascertain their skillset and ability to produce and perform. The manager expects hard work, loyalty to the team and manager, and a trustworthy demeanor from the new team member during this stage.
